Output 6857fac8d3a8f4101234522d45a87fc6435e4da3b4820448ce204e80487399c2:7

value
7511903
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f40f31b0dac2e00046fb2ea67a848c8ef105832 OP_EQUALVERIFY OP_CHECKSIG
address
16mTNsAHuriPtREDLiUzd5FZBAQUf9Xv7M
transaction
6857fac8d3a8f4101234522d45a87fc6435e4da3b4820448ce204e80487399c2
spent
true